'EYES OF THE DRAGON'
STEPHEN KING EPIC FANTASY TO BECOME HULU TV SERIES
Fantasy today: the latest epic fantasy to be adapted into a TV series is Stephen King's THE EYES OF THE DRAGON which will bring kings, princes, dragons, fairies and elves to Hulu which has put Seth Grahame
Smith as a showrunner. In it King Roland’s manipulative magician, Flagg, sees his power threatened when Queen Sasha gives birth to Peter, an heir to the throne of Delain. When the queen is pregnant with a second son, Flagg gets her midwife to mortally wound the queen and so begins his plot to dispose of the future king. Peter brings wine to his father’s bed chambers each night and Flagg poisons the potion and frames the son. The magician has meanwhile also been manipulating the younger son, Thomas, showing him secret passages where the boy can spy on his father. Thomas sees the murder of the king and the frameup of his brother, but is torn when Peter is found guilty and locked in an enormous tower. After all with Peter gone, he’s king at age 12. He allows Flagg widespread power that corrupts the kingdom. Meanwhile, Peter must attempt an escape to thwart Flagg and win back the throne.

'WESTWORLD' SEASON 3
TRAILER WITH AARON PAUL
The series itself ain't returning till next year (it is the only series that comes every two years), but HBO has revealed the first trailer for the third season of their high concept sf series WESTWORLD featuring Aaron Paul as the
main character in it - and a surprise glimpse of Evan Rachel Wood at the very end: does this mean the androids are out and ready to wreck chaos in the real world too? Vincent Cassel will play a villain.
